This is the 1957-58 Manitoba Junior Hockey League Season.
League Notes
Brandon Wheat Kings leave of absence extended.
League admited the Winnipeg Braves.
Winnipeg Rangers moved to Brandon, becoming the Brandon Rangers.
Winnipeg Barons fold.
League scheduled 60 games, 30 per team.
For January, the Rangers moved to Transcona and were rename the Transcona Rangers.
Regular Season
Team | GP | W | L | T | GF | GA | PTS |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Winnipeg Monarchs | 30 | 18 | 11 | 1 | 167 | 128 | 37 |
St. Boniface Canadiens | 30 | 17 | 11 | 2 | 146 | 132 | 36 |
Winnipeg Braves | 30 | 13 | 16 | 1 | 144 | 135 | 27 |
Transcona Rangers | 30 | 10 | 20 | 0 | 128 | 190 | 20 |

League Leaders
Category | Player | Team | Amount |
---|---|---|---|
Most Points | Gord Labossiere | Transcona Rangers | 79 |
Most Goals | Gord Labossiere | Transcona Rangers | 44 |
Most Assists | Billy Saunders | Winnipeg Monarchs | 44 |
Top Goals Against Average | Ron Mathers | Winnipeg Monarchs | 4.21 |
League Record
Player | Team | Achievement | Amount |
---|---|---|---|
Claude Normandeau | St. Boniface Canadiens | Most Goals--Right Wing | 41 |
Scoring Leaders
Rank | Player | Team | G | A | Pts |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
1 | Gord Labossiere | Transcona Rangers | 44 | 35 | 79 |
2 | Billy Saunders | Winnipeg Monarchs | 32 | 44 | 76 |
3 | Claude Normandeau | St. Boniface Canadiens | 41 | 18 | 59 |
Don Atamanchuk | Transcona Rangers | 32 | 27 | 59 | |
5 | Bill Colpitts | Winnipeg Monarchs | 23 | 24 | 47 |
6 | Bill Wicklow | Winnipeg Monarchs | 22 | 20 | 42 |
Ken Saunders | St. Boniface Canadiens | 20 | 22 | 42 | |
8 | Al Baty | Winnipeg Braves | 21 | 19 | 40 |
9 | Laurie Langrell | Winnipeg Braves | 19 | 19 | 38 |
10 | Wayne Larkin | Winnipeg Braves | 20 | 17 | 37 |
Awards
Trophy | Winner | Team |
---|---|---|
MVP | Gord Labossiere | Transcona Rangers |
Scoring Champion | Gord Labossiere | Transcona Rangers |
All-Star Teams
First All-Star Team | ||
---|---|---|
Goaltender | Ron Mathers | Winnipeg Monarchs |
Defensemen | Bill McDowell | Winnipeg Monarchs |
Connie Neil | Transcona Rangers | |
Centerman | Gord Labossiere | Transcona Rangers |
Leftwinger | Laurie Langrell | Winnipeg Braves |
Rightwinger | Claude Normandeau | St. Boniface Canadiens |
Coach | Bill Allum | Winnipeg Braves |
Manager | Lloyd Frihager | St. Boniface Canadiens |
Second All-Star Team | ||
Goaltender | Don Shalley | St. Boniface Canadiens |
Defensemen | Ted Lanyon | St. Boniface Canadiens |
Bob Donas | St. Boniface Canadiens | |
Centerman | Billy Saunders | Winnipeg Monarchs |
Leftwinger | Al LeBlanc | Winnipeg Braves |
Rightwinger | Bill Colpitts | Winnipeg Monarchs |
Coach | Bill Leask | Winnipeg Monarchs |
Manager | Ray Frost | Transcona Rangers |
